Christian Horner’s life chapter this week reads like the next act in a very modern Formula One saga, where the paddock powerbroker swaps the pit wall for the boardroom, even as whispers about a racing comeback refuse to die down. According to GPFans, Horner has taken on a **new role as an adviser to London based private equity firm Oakley Capital**, his first major position since his high profile exit as Red Bull Racing team principal in the summer of 2025. GPFans reports that this move places Horner in a broader sports and media investment space, signaling a potential long term shift in his professional identity from team boss to sports business strategist, and giving him a platform that could shape multiple disciplines, not just Formula One, in the years ahead. NewsNow’s aggregation of coverage on Christian Horner highlights that his dismissal from Red Bull in July 2025, after nearly two decades at the helm and multiple world championships, still frames almost every new story about him, underscoring how any fresh job, appearance, or rumor is now weighed against the legacy and controversy of that departure. That biographical shadow is critical: every development is read as either rehabilitation, reinvention, or positioning for a return. Motorsport.com adds fuel to the speculation side of the narrative, reporting comments from McLaren Racing CEO Zak Brown saying he would be “shocked” if Horner did not return to Formula One at some point. Those remarks, while clearly speculative and not tied to any confirmed negotiation or role, show that key industry figures still see Horner as a major asset in the paddock and help keep his name in the long term conversation for top jobs whenever team politics, ownership changes, or performance crises open a door. On the more speculative media front, YouTube and fan commentary channels continue to push the storyline that Horner faces multiple informal vetoes or resistance to an F1 comeback, but these are not backed by hard, on the record reporting and should be treated as unconfirmed gossip rather than established fact. For now, the verifiable story is this: Christian Horner, once the longest serving and most successful team principal of the hybrid era, has stepped into high level sports investment advising, while powerful voices in the sport publicly predict he will be back on the grid someday. The long term biographical stakes are clear – if Oakley Capital becomes a launchpad for bigger business influence or a bridge back to F1 ownership or management, this week will read as a pivotal turning point in his post Red Bull life.
